General Description The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 is an integrated naval ESM/ECM suite designed to enhance ship survivability by creating an electromagnetic defense shield. The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2, a 4th generation system, implements Elisra's extensive experience in designing, manufacturing and commissioning naval EW systems for the Israeli Navy and foreign navies. The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 receives and identifies over-the-horizon signals with a 100% probability of intercept. Instantaneous frequency and DF measurements are performed on a per-pulse basis. Sophisticated signal processing algorithms enable the N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 to operate in a dense electromagnetic environment. Special techniques are used to intercept and analyze exotic signals such as: chirp, frequency hopping, staggered PRF, etc. Upon identification of a threat, the system alerts the operator by activating audio and visual alarms. ECM response is activated automatically. "Tailored" transmission techniques are used to counter each specific threat. The ECM response is generated by an advanced Techniques Generator, a Low Power Exciter and a High Power Multi Beam Array Transmitter - MBAT. The ECM system architecture enables simultaneous engagement of multiple enemy missiles as well as other threats. The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 provides many advanced tactical ELINT features such as: PRF analysis, frequency profile analysis, radar scan pattern analysis, emitter signals video display, etc. Recording facilities are provided to store and replay the electromagnetic environment data for subsequent analysis. The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 is fully integrable and interoperable with other on-board systems, such as: command and control, chaff/flare launchers, hard-kill weapons, fire control systems, radars, navigation system, etc. The NS-9003A-V2/9005A-V2 is operated by a single operator console or operated from the user multi function console via LAN. It comprises various types of display: graphic situation, alphanumeric and optional video. The Human-Machine Interface (HMI) is Windows based, with task oriented menus, toolbars, windows, general purpose keyboards, track ball and provides an easy and user-friendly systems operation. Extensive BIT capabilities enable on-line monitoring of the systems during normal operation, and off-line fault location for repair at the LRU/SRU level.
